This 12 week, full-time, personal development programme is aimed at young people aged 16-25 years old

It improves your chances of moving into a job, education or training. Practical projects and team-working exercises will all give you a real sense of achievement and the skills you need to move forwards in the future.

How does it work?

The team are encouraged to work autonomously to aid development and undertake a number of challenges over the 12 weeks, including:-

  • Team building
  • Social action project
  • Work experience
  • Supporting others in the community
  • Final presentation
Northampton- The Prince's Trust Programme.

Week 1 - 2

WEEK 1: Induction week – Over this week, you’ll start planning for the weeks ahead, setting out what you want to achieve and planning for a week away.

WEEK 2: Local Activities – You’ll spend this week trying new things and learning how to work with others. This gives you a chance to break away from your current situation. The sort of things you could do include abseiling, rock climbing, caving and much more!

Week 3 - 8

WEEKS 3-6: Community Project – As a team you’ll decide on a project to benefit your local community and carry it out. You might be surprised at what you can achieve together. This gives you great experience to talk about at interviews.

WEEKS 7-8: Work Placements – This is the time to see how the skills you’ve developed so far can help you in the workplace. It’s also a great chance to try out a type of work, or company to see whether you like it.

Week 9 - 12

WEEK 9: Next steps – Time to plan your next steps after the programme. You’ll get professional help to write a fantastic CV, practice your interview skills and make applications.

WEEKS 10–11: Team Challenge – You and your team will take on a challenge to help others in the community. This is when you get to test out all the skills you’ll have worked on so far.

WEEK 12: Final Presentation – In your final week you’ll deliver a presentation with your team to an invited audience. This is your chance to show off the talents you’ve discovered. This may sound scary now, but after 12 weeks on the team you’ll be surprised at how far you’ve come.
